你查询的IP:[121.89.37.186]  地理位置:中国阿里云

最新查询118.228.2.81 119.144.16.0 119.58.137.64 125.169.67.78 219.72.25.222 221.81.252.31 59.64.124.239 122.234.128.1 59.108.18.139 121.89.37.186 119.63.32.174 61.87.192.64 119.63.32.151 116.89.144.63 119.108.39.116 203.90.192.17 116.207.26.37 202.91.224.255 203.128.96.229 203.135.160.14 125.215.116.39 124.112.64.56 202.92.244.190 221.133.224.162 203.158.16.55 220.154.104.83 117.80.184.122 202.46.224.125 125.62.197.152 202.127.128.110 202.4.128.127